Grosvenor P. Lowrey (September 25, 1831 – April 21, 1893) was a 19th-century American corporate lawyer who served as counsel to numerous powerful interests such as Thomas Edison, Western Union, Wells Fargo and the New York Metropolitan Railway Company. After graduating from Lafayette College in 1854 Lowrey was admitted to the bar he became the personal secretary to his former teacher Andrew Horatio Reeder, the first Governor of the Kansa… WebTheodore Dreiser interviews Edison for Success Magazine, 1898.
